Detailed vulnerability description

The vulnerability allows a local user to perform a denial of service (DoS) attack.

The vulnerability exists due to improper locking within the host1x_intr_init() function in drivers/gpu/host1x/intr.c, within the host1x_probe() function in drivers/gpu/host1x/dev.c. A local user can perform a denial of service (DoS) attack.
